VISITING TRAIL EXPERTS WILL INSPIRE LOCAL TRAILBUILDING
Subaru/IMBA Trail Care Crew Coming to Winnemucca and Battle Mountain
The International Mountain Bicycling Association’s (IMBA) Subaru/IMBA Trail Care Crew will be visiting Winnemucca and Battle Mountain on May 13-16 to talk trails, teach people proper trailbuilding technique, and spend quality time digging in the dirt. The visit is one of 70 stops on the 2004 schedule. Everyone is invited to attend the weekend’s events!
The award-winning Subaru/IMBA Trail Care Crew program includes two full-time, professional teams of trail experts who travel North America year-round, leading IMBA Trailbuilding Schools, meeting with government officials and land managers, and working with IMBA-affiliated groups to improve mountain biking opportunities. IMBA’s crews have lead more than 1,000 trail projects since the program debuted in 1997.
The Trail Care Crew visit will last four days. This allows time to assess local trails, host an evening slide show, conduct a trailbuilding school and ride with the locals. This program has inspired great volunteer trail work across the U.S. and has been a big help to government agencies and land managers who have limited funding for trail construction and upkeep.
